Stephen O'Brien
Stephen O'Brien was a Liberal Democrats candidate in Grindon & Thorney Close in the Sunderland local election. They were elected with 1,678 votes.

| Date | Election | Party | Results | Position |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2026 | Grindon & Thorney Close: Sunderland local election | Liberal Democrats | Elected (1,678 votes) | 2nd / 12 candidates |
| 2023 | Sandhill: Sunderland local election | Liberal Democrats | Elected (1,457 votes) | 1st / 5 candidates |
| 2019 | Sandhill: Sunderland local election | Liberal Democrats | Elected (1,050 votes) | 1st / 10 candidates |
| 2016 | Southwick: Sunderland local election | Liberal Democrats | Not elected (80 votes) | 4th / 5 candidates |
